Synopsis

The aim of this course is to expand the postgraduate student's knowledge of the changes that occur with normal ageing, the pathophysiology of ageing and the preventative, and therapeutic measures to promote the older persons' safety and quality of life. Learning outcomes will address key concepts such as normal ageing, age related p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amics changes associated with the use of medications and complementary therapies, comprehensive geriatric assessment, mental health and wellbeing, ethical and cultural considerations, risk assessment and health promotion. This course will contribute to the ongoing development of nurses' qualities as leaders, especially as change agents in their respective health practice contexts that improve the care experience and quality of life of older people.
